General notes
- Description
- Ibn al-Tilmīdh, Hibat Allāh ibn Ṣāʻid, 1073 or 1074-1164 or 1165 was his teacher, and almost certainly his father. Some sources say his brother was Ibn al-Masīḥī, Saʻīd ibn Abī al-Khayr, 1177-1259 or 1260, but I don't see how this is possible.

- Description
- Abuʼl-Ḥasan (Ḥusain) Ṣāʻid ibn Hibatallāh ibn al-Muʼammal from al-Ḥaṣīra, practicing physician in Baghdad, author of a seemingly lost medical work; died 1195
